Dolores May "Dolly" Hanson, age 75 of Antrim, went to be with the Lord on December 27, 2015 in SEORMC in Cambridge.
She was born March 16, 1940 in Akron, Ohio, a daughter of the late John and Emma Lucas.
She is survived by her husband of 57 years, William F. Hanson; one sister, Teresa Ramnytz; three daughters: Kim (Paul) Cooper, Kristy (Ed) Voorhies, Theresa (Jordy) Mitchell; and one son, Bill (fiancée Rose) Hanson; a daughter-in-law, Judy Hanson; eight grandchildren who she loved greatly, nine great grandchildren, and several nieces and nephews. She was preceded in death by a son, Kenneth Hanson, two grandsons, a brother, a sister, and a nephew.
Dolly was a strong spirit that cherished her family members and all of the many memories that they provided. She built her foundation on the hardships that stood in her path, all the while holding her loved ones close. Dolores was a bold soul with her words, always willing to cook one too many things for social gatherings. She was creative, playful, and found ways to close the gaps of differences that would otherwise separate individuals of the family. Among a taste for shopping and puzzle books, she enjoyed spending time at the lake, relishing the beauties that this world provided. She was a woman that never left an embrace unrecognized, and held fast to her stubborn will, inevitably making the final decision to go home, leaving us all with hearts forced to accept, but never forgetting the parts she has touched.
Services will be held at 11:00 a.m. Wednesday, December 30, 2015 in Antrim Mennonite Church with Pastors Eli Schrock and Pastor Frederick Helmuth officiating. Visitation will be held from 6:00 to 8:00 p.m. also in the Antrim Mennonite Church on Tuesday, December 29, 2015. Burial will follow in Antrim Presbyterian Cemetery.
